Shingle Damage
One of the most frequent types of roof repair involves damaged or missing shingles. In Carriere, high winds during thunderstorms can lift or detach shingles, leaving the underlying roof deck exposed. Age and UV exposure also cause shingles to curl, crack, or lose their protective granules, diminishing their ability to shed water effectively.
Leaks and Water Intrusion
Water is the silent enemy of any property. Roof leaks often begin subtly, perhaps as a small stain on your ceiling in a room near a chimney or vent. These leaks can originate from cracked flashing around chimneys, vents, or skylights, or from damaged seals on roof penetrations. Addressing these leaks promptly is crucial to prevent mold growth and structural rot.
Flashing Failures
The metal flashing installed around roof penetrations and valleys is designed to create a watertight barrier. However, over time, this flashing can corrode, lift, or crack, creating prime entry points for water. Repairing or replacing faulty flashing is a specialized form of roof repair that requires precision.
Granule Loss
Asphalt shingles contain small granules that protect the asphalt from UV rays and provide fire resistance. When these granules begin to wear off, often seen as a gritty buildup in your gutters, it indicates that the shingles are degrading and losing their protective qualities and color.
The Roof Repair Process in Carriere
When you notice an issue with your roof, it’s important to contact experienced local roofing professionals in Carriere. The repair process typically involves several steps designed to ensure a lasting solution.
Inspection and Assessment
A qualified roofing contractor will begin with a thorough inspection of your roof. This involves a visual examination from the ground and, if safely accessible, a close-up inspection of the roof surface. Professionals will look for signs of damage such as missing or cracked shingles, soft spots in the decking, damaged flashing, and clogged gutters. They will also investigate any reported interior signs of leaks to pinpoint the source.
Material Selection and Preparation
Based on the assessment, the roofer will determine the necessary repairs and the most suitable materials. For shingle replacement, this involves matching the existing shingle type, color, and manufacturer as closely as possible. For leaks, specialized sealants or new flashing might be required. The area to be repaired will be cleaned and prepared to ensure proper adhesion of new materials.
Performing the Repairs
Roof repair techniques vary depending on the issue. For minor shingle damage, a roofer might carefully remove the damaged shingle, slide a new one underneath the surrounding shingles, and secure it with roofing nails. For more extensive damage or leaks, sections of underlayment or decking may need to be replaced before new shingles are installed. Flashing repairs often involve removing old sealant, cleaning the area, and installing new metal flashing and appropriate sealants.
Tools and Materials Commonly Used
Local roofing professionals in Carriere utilize a range of specialized tools and high-quality materials to complete roof repairs effectively. These typically include:
Roofing Shingles: Matching asphalt shingles, architectural shingles, or other suitable materials depending on the existing roof.
Underlayment: Synthetic or felt underlayment to provide an extra layer of protection.
Roofing Nails: Galvanized nails designed to withstand outdoor conditions and secure shingles effectively.
Roofing Cement/Sealants: Specialized adhesives and waterproof sealants to secure flashing and seal gaps.
Roofing Knives and Saws: For cutting shingles and removing damaged sections.
Pry Bars and Hammers: For removing old materials and installing new ones.
Caulking Guns: For precise application of sealants.
Safety Equipment: Including harnesses, ropes, and sturdy footwear for safe working at heights.
Benefits of Timely Roof Repair
Addressing roof issues as soon as they are detected offers significant advantages for homeowners and businesses in Carriere. Proactive repair can save both time and money in the long run.
Preventing Further Damage
A small leak, if left unaddressed, can lead to extensive water damage to insulation, drywall, and wooden structures within your home. This can result in costly repairs and the potential for mold and mildew growth, which can be detrimental to indoor air quality.
Maintaining Structural Integrity
Water intrusion can weaken the structural components of your roof and house. Rotting wood in rafters and decking can compromise the overall stability of your home, especially in the face of strong winds common in Mississippi.
Enhancing Energy Efficiency
A damaged roof can create drafts and allow conditioned air to escape your home, leading to increased energy bills. Timely repairs ensure your roof remains a proper barrier against the elements, helping to maintain a comfortable indoor temperature and reduce energy consumption.
Protecting Property Value
A well-maintained roof is a significant factor in the curb appeal and overall value of your property. Addressing repair needs promptly shows that you are a diligent homeowner and can prevent larger, more visibly unappealing issues from developing.

Frequently Asked Questions About Roof Repair in Carriere
What are the most common signs I need roof repair in Carriere, MS?
In Carriere, you should be vigilant for cracked, curling, or missing shingles, visible water stains on your ceilings or walls (especially after heavy rain), new mold or mildew growth, and increased energy bills. Also, check your gutters for excessive amounts of shingle granules, a sign of wear.
How does the humid climate of Mississippi affect my roof?
The high humidity and frequent rainfall in Mississippi can accelerate the deterioration of roofing materials. It promotes the growth of moss and algae, which retain moisture and can lead to premature shingle decay. Furthermore, the extreme temperature fluctuations can cause materials to expand and contract, leading to cracks and leaks over time.
What types of roofing materials are common in Carriere homes?
Asphalt shingles are very common on residential properties in Carriere due to their affordability and durability. You may also find homes with metal roofing, which is known for its longevity and resistance to high winds and severe weather, or sometimes older homes might feature wood shakes. Understanding your existing material is key when seeking roof repair.

Will homeowners insurance cover Roof Repair in Carriere?
Insurance typically covers sudden storm damage — hail, wind, and falling trees — but not gradual wear or pre-existing deterioration. Document all damage with photos immediately after a storm and contact your insurer before any repair work begins.
Can I do Roof Repair myself?
Replacing one or two displaced shingles is manageable for a confident DIYer with proper ladder safety; flashing repairs around chimneys and valleys require complex sealing and are best handled by a licensed roofer
